Quasi-maximum Likelihood Estimation of Discretely Observed Diffusions∗

This paper introduces quasi-maximum likelihood estimator for discretely observed diffusions when a closed-form transition density is unavailable. Higher order Wagner-Platen strong approximation is used to derive the first two conditional moments and a normal density function is used in estimation. Estimation for Discretely Observed Diffusions using Transform Functions

This paper introduces a new estimation technique for discretely observed diffusion processes. Transform functions are applied to transform the data to obtain good and easily calculated estimators of both the drift and diffusion coefficients. Estimation in discretely observed diffusions killed at a threshold

Parameter estimation in diffusion processes from discrete observations up to a first-hitting time is clearly of practical relevance, but does not seem to have been studied so far. In neuroscience, many models for the membrane potential evolution involve the presence of an upper threshold. Monte Carlo maximum likelihood estimation for discretely observed diffusion processes

This paper introduces a Monte Carlo method for maximum likelihood inference in the context of discretely observed diffusion processes. The method gives unbiased and a.s. continuous estimators of the likelihood function for a family of diffusion models and its performance in numerical examples is computationally efficient. On Likelihood Estimation for Discretely Observed Markov Jump Processes

The parameter estimation problem for a Markov jump process sampled at equidistant time points is considered here. Unlike the diffusion case where a closed form of the likelihood function is usually unavailable, here an explicit expansion of the likelihood function of the sampled chain is provided.
